Narendra Modi
Modi has been the chief minister of Gujarat since October 2001and still holds the office. He is the longest serving chief minister of Gujarat. This year recorded his hatrick win as the CM of Gujarat. Now he is up against Congress Party secretary Rahul Gandhi for the PM’s position in the 2014 general elections. Modi is one of the longest serving CMs in the country, who has brought many advances in Gujarat through his astute leadership.

Manmohan Singh
Manmohan Singh is in his second term as India’s Prime Minister and the stability of the UPA government has been questioned frequently, whether it will make it till the next general elections. He was tagged as an ‘Underachiever’ last year by TIME magazine; however, his leadership has fetched the Indian economy the $1 Trillion milestone.
